Container PV Storage EPC Pricing in South Africa

You know what's wild? A sun-drenched nation like South Africa's been struggling with 6-10 hour daily blackouts in 2023. Eskom's ageing infrastructure and coal dependency have pushed electricity tariffs up 650% since 2007. But here's the kicker – the same country receives over 2,500 hours of annual sunlight.

Container Solar Panels: Revolutionizing Renewable Energy

shipping containers transformed into power plants. That's essentially what containerized solar systems offer – modular solar arrays housed in standard ISO containers. In 2023 alone, the global market for these systems grew by 17%, proving they're not just a passing fad but a legitimate solution to our energy woes.
